"Boston" Summit and the possibility of Wayland Accessibility Hacking

W3C Updates

  • No news specifically from W3C, but in ARIA-related news, Joseph will giving a talk at the jQuery accessibility summit Oct 10-11.
  • http://www.deque.com/deque-partners-jquery-create-accessibility-summit

  • Joanie has requested, and appears very like to get, "Invited Expert" status.
  • Joanie will be looking at current "mappings" for HTML and ARIA with the aim of adding new API to ATK/AT-SPI2 where needed for better a11y support.

Marketing

  • The release notes for GNOME 3.10 are done, and now it is in the translation phase.
  • Unfortunately, the magnifier's focus and caret tracking notes have been dropped because the lack of GUI.
  • The accessibility bits has been consolidated with the rest of the notes, instead of having a separated section.
